It’s much easier to keep your working place tidy than to clean it every day. It’s not a secret that when the workplace is cleaned up, the work becomes more enjoyable, more efficient and even safer.
So, for the beginning, let’s clean our workplace.

Workplace cleaning

Piles of papers and folders cover your entire table. It’s difficult to find the needed documents… sounds familiar?

  • Stop doing what you are doing!
  • Cleaning of any office starts with the papers and documents. Get rid of those that are not necessary. Do not leave them if you are sure you won’t need them.
  • Make sure that the documents are places into the right folders.
  • If you have hundreds of pieces of papers with numbers or other information, write all the information down on one piece of paper, or start using your notebook.

In order to bring your office in order take time to make sure that everything is under control.

  • Make up a weekly plan on cleaning the office.
  • At the end of the day you must go home leaving the office clean.
  • All the papers should be filed or placed in special folders as soon as you finish working with them.

10 Most Useful Tips

  1. Make a list with the cleaning activities that should be done.
  2. The mail that is received should be classified: “Urgent/Important”, “Non-urgent/Not important”, “Intermediate”. “Intermediate” is a folder for the correspondence, priority of which can not be defined.
  3. File or put in special folders all the documents as soon as you finish working with them.
  4. Attach the priorities to the specific tasks that should be done.
  5. Throw away everything that you don’t need.
  6. Wash the cups and put all the pens and pencils in one place.
  7. Keep your workplace in order.
  8. Check your “Intermediate” folder regularly.
  9. Cross out the tasks from the to-do-list that have already been done.
  10. The to-do-list for the next week should be rewritten beforehand.
